The study aims to determine the advantages and disadvantages of AI sites on academic engagement of secondary education students at Kabacan Sandigan Colleges Inc. It seeks to identify the socio-demographic variables involved, examine the relationship between academic engagement and AI, and provide insights for educational stakeholders including students and future researchers .
Students' perceptions of AI affect their engagement with academic content by influencing their willingness to use AI tools, and their adaptability to AI-enhanced learning environments . Positive perceptions can enhance engagement and learning efficiency, while negative perceptions may act as barriers, highlighting the importance of addressing perception-related challenges for successful AI integration .
AI technology can support diverse educational needs by offering personalized learning experiences tailored to individual student profiles . Through adaptive learning systems, AI can adjust content and pedagogy according to student performance and preferences, thereby facilitating more effective, individualized learning paths that cater to varying educational requirements .
Understanding students' socio-demographic profiles helps tailor AI applications to better match student needs, thereby enhancing academic engagement . Different demographic factors such as gender, program year, and other characteristics can influence how students interact with and benefit from AI technologies, making demographic profiling essential for effective AI integration .
Ethical considerations in AI ensure that AI systems in education are deployed with fairness, transparency, accountability, and respect for human values . It addresses potential biases, ensures privacy, and fosters trust among users. Educators and policymakers must consider these ethics to prevent misuse and ensure AI benefits all students equitably, safeguarding against ethical dilemmas in learning environments .

AI can automate repetitive administrative tasks such as document management and workflow optimization . This implementation allows administrators to allocate resources more efficiently by freeing up human resources for higher-level tasks like decision-making and policy implementation, thus potentially leading to improved institutional efficiency .
The TPACK framework helps educators by providing a structured approach to integrating AI into teaching practices. It emphasizes the interplay between technology, pedagogy, and content knowledge, ensuring that technology use enhances rather than disrupts learning . This framework guides teachers in applying technology effectively, thus making AI integration a part of cohesive teaching strategies that improve student learning outcomes .
